I'm a developer for a third party program called Windower, which is used with Final Fantasy XI.
Love dgvoodoo2! It greatly improves and band-aids a lot of issues with Final Fantasy XI. Installation of dgvoodoo2 on the game pretty much always go flawlessly.
This time though, we have someone that is having an issue and we're pretty stumped. We're certain that dgvoodoo2 is being loaded because, without it, the game crashes when you lock windows and log back in. But with it, it stays open just fine.
But, despite what settings we choose, its not actually using the graphics card, its using the CPU. Which is extra odd since, it uses the graphics card just fine when dgvoodoo2 is uninstalled (Verified in task manager).

AMB Radeon RX 6900 XT.

Have tried it with both "All of them" and the graphics card selected. And are using typical (mostly default) settings and have tried some optional settings too.

Any thoughts on what we should try/check and how to debug? Thanks!

Update: Before I posted they had reinstalled the latest graphics drivers as part of debugging. They say now that "rolled my video drivers back to the first release of win11 from sept of last year and [its working properly now]". So, its at least working, curious if there are any thoughts on those driver issues, although probably nothing dgvoodoo can do about it.

The GPU selection problem is very strange. You can check out the dgVoodoo log, the selected backend device is listed in it, along with the information whether it's hw accelerated or sw (WARP) device.
Indeed, if it's listed as hw accelerated but the sw WARP device is used in the background then I think it's a problem that cannot be fixed on dgVoodoo side.
Maybe it affect(ed) other DX11/12 games as well?
